What are the key components of powder coating equipment?

Key Components of Powder Coating Equipment

Introduction

Powder coating is a finishing process that involves the application of a dry, thermoplastic powder to a surface, which is then cured under heat to form a durable finish. The process involves several specialized pieces of equipment that ensure efficient and effective coating. Key Components of Powder Coating Equipment

Powder Spray Gun

The powder spray gun is an essential component that electrostatically charges the powder particles, ensuring they adhere to the grounded metal surface. Modern spray guns feature advanced technologies such as dual-voltage settings and adjustable spray patterns to enhance precision and minimize waste.

Powder Booth

The powder booth contains the powder application environment to prevent contamination and ensure safety. It is equipped with an efficient air filtration system to capture overspray. Booths are constructed with varying sizes to accommodate different product dimensions.

Curing Oven

The curing oven is where the coated parts are heated to a temperature that allows the powder to melt and form a solid coating. Standard parameters include temperatures ranging from 180°C to 210°C and curing times between 10 to 30 minutes, depending on the powder formula.

Powder Recovery System

This system recovers excess powder from the application process to be reused, significantly reducing material wastage. Cyclonic and cartridge systems are commonly employed, offering recovery rates of up to 95%.

Application Control System

The control system regulates the application process parameters such as voltage, air pressure, and spray patterns. Advanced control units may include features like data logging and remote system monitoring for enhanced process oversight.
